Technological Advancements
One of the most significant contributions of space exploration to life on Earth is the technological advancements it has spurred. Many of the technologies developed for space missions have found their way into everyday products and services. For instance, the development of satellite technology has revolutionized communication, allowing people to stay connected across vast distances. GPS systems, originally designed for navigation in space, are now used in everything from smartphones to cars, making navigation and location services more accessible and accurate.
Medical Breakthroughs
Space exploration has also played a crucial role in medical advancements. The study of microgravity and the effects of space travel on the human body has led to a better understanding of diseases and conditions such as osteoporosis, muscle atrophy, and cardiovascular issues. This knowledge has helped in the development of new treatments and therapies for these conditions, improving the quality of life for millions of people on Earth.
Environmental Monitoring
Space exploration has provided us with the ability to monitor and study the Earth from space, leading to better understanding of environmental issues. Satellites equipped with advanced sensors can track changes in climate, monitor pollution levels, and detect natural disasters. This information is crucial for policymakers and scientists in developing strategies to mitigate the effects of climate change and protect the environment.
